Municipality Description
Montagnola is a very charming and sought-after residential village located on the sunny Collina d’Oro, just a few minutes from the centre of Lugano. It is considered one of the most exclusive and tranquil residential areas in the Lugano region, particularly appreciated for its privacy, safety and high quality of life. The picturesque village is set within a landscape of exceptional quality, surrounded by vineyards, meadows and panoramic woodlands overlooking Lake Lugano. The municipal territory extends down to the lakeshore, offering a particularly diverse and attractive natural setting. The municipality of Collina d’Oro was formed in 2004 through the merger of the villages of Gentilino, Agra and Montagnola, combining the charm of historic village centres with prestigious residences immersed in greenery. Montagnola is closely linked to the German writer Hermann Hesse, who lived here for many years: the Hermann Hesse Museum, housed in the Torre Camuzzi next to the historic Casa Camuzzi, preserves valuable testimonies of his life and work. The writer is buried in the nearby cemetery of Gentilino, beside the idyllic Church of Sant’Abbondio. The presence of the renowned international school TASIS - The American School in Switzerland, together with its privileged location, contributes to making Montagnola one of the most desirable and exclusive residential areas of the Lugano region. Montagnola has approximately 2’369 inhabitants and lies at 467 m above sea level.
